实心橡胶轮胎稳态温度场分析

摘    要:分析车辆实心橡胶轮胎稳态温度场。方法建立力学、热学有限元分析混合模型,利用非线性有限元分析软件ANSYS进行分析。结果轮胎稳态温度场具有一定特点,其最高温度随车速升高而升高,随轮胎表面散热系数增大而缓慢降低。结论车辆实心橡胶轮胎的混合模型分析是合理的和重要的;分析结果为轮胎的寿命分析提供了基础。

Analysis of Static Temperature Field of Vehicle's Solid Rubber Tire

Abstract:Aim To analyse the static temperature field ofthe solid rubber tire(SRT).Methods The mechanical and thermal FE models were developed and analyzed respectively with the FE software ANSYS.Results The maximum temperature becomes higher with the higher with the higher velocity of tire and scales down slightly with the higher convection coefficients.The mixed models are reasonable.Conclusion The study on static temperature field is important and reasonable.It gives the fundament for life analysis of SRT.
